About David Aaron Rappaport at a glance

David Aaron Rappaport is a Carmax based in Washington, District of Columbia. They have 22+ years of legal experience, licensed to practice since 2004. Their practice focuses on employment and litigation. Admitted to practice in Virginia (2004), U.S. District Court, Western and Eastern Districts of Virginia (2004), District of Columbia U.S. Court of Appeals, Eighth Circuit (2005), and U.S. District Court for the District of Columbia (2005). Educated at Washington & Lee University School of Law (J.D., 2003) and James Madison University (B.S., 1999). Serands clients in Washington, DC and the surrounding metropolitan area.

Jurisdictional Context

Why local counsel matters in District of Columbia

Practicing law in District of Columbia. Legal matters in District of Columbia are governed by state-specific rules of civil and criminal procedure, statutes of limitations, and substantive law. Cases originating in Washington are typically filed in the local municipal court or the appropriate District of Columbia state district court, depending on subject matter and amount in controversy. An attorney licensed in District of Columbia brings working knowledge of local procedural deadlines, judicial practices in this andnue, and the substantive law that applies to cases brought here. Out-of-state attorneys generally cannot represent clients in District of Columbia courts without local counsel or pro hac vice admission.
